1. IMPORTANT : Nouvelles mesures de sécurité - 2. Règles pour obtenir de l'aide dans les forums de support - 3. Restrictions des droits pour le groupe "Support suspendu"
Il est obligatoire de respecter les Règles de MyBB.fr : Version abrégée ou Version complète pour obtenir du support sur nos forums.
Les membres ayant un site/forum contrevenant aux règles de MyBB.support seront placés dans le groupe "Support suspendu" et ne bénéficieront plus du support du staff. Nous recommandons aux autres membres d'agir de même. Il ne s'agit pas d'un bannissement, le membre retrouvera son statut "normal" dès que sa situation sera conforme aux règles.
Nouveau : un Wiki en français : plus de détails.
Avant de soumettre votre problème, consultez-le, ainsi que la FAQ, sans oublier le moteur de recherche interne.
Page Manager Erreur
Mots-clés » page, manager, erreur |
02-01-2017, 23:33,
|
|||
|
|||
Page Manager Erreur
VERSION_MyBB : 1.8.9 Bonsoir, Je viens à l'instant d'installer Page manager, sauf que lorsque je créer une page j'obtient une erreur dans le menu page manager.. La page fonctionne parfaitement mais je ne peux n'y la modifier, ni la supprimer ou en créer une autre.. La seul solution pour cela est de Désinstaller le plugin et retour à la case départ. Auriez vous une solution ? Merci |
|||
02-01-2017, 23:45,
|
|||
|
|||
RE: Page Manager Erreur
Ce plugin est pour la version 1.6.x de MyBB, pour la version 1.8.x il faut installer :
https://community.mybb.com/mods.php?action=view&pid=486 |
|||
02-01-2017, 23:58,
|
|||
|
|||
RE: Page Manager Erreur
C'est pourtant celui-la que j'ai installer. Pour en être sur j'ai retiré l'ancien plugin pour mettre celui-ci et j'ai exactement les mêmes erreurs
|
|||
03-01-2017, 4:22,
(Modification du message : 03-01-2017, 4:25 par exdiogene.)
|
|||
|
|||
RE: Page Manager Erreur
Pourtant quand j'ai vérifié le plugin 1.5.2, avec le Panneau d'Administration, le lien pointait vers la version 1.6.x sur MyBB.com :
http://mods.mybb.com/view/page-manager Le problème provient des dernières versions de PHP (la votre est 7.1.0) qui affiche une erreur lorsque nous vérifions le contenu d'un tableau et que l'élément n'existe pas, par exemple : Code PHP : if(!isset($cell['extra']['class'])){ Cela va causé une erreur si "$cell['extra']" n'existe pas! Il faudrait changer cela pour : Code PHP : if(isset($cell['extra']) && !isset($cell['extra']['class'])){ |
|||
03-01-2017, 5:17,
(Modification du message : 03-01-2017, 5:18 par drakdia.)
|
|||
|
|||
RE: Page Manager Erreur
Malgré avoir changé cela, il y a toujours le même problème.
J'ai donc remis de base Code PHP : function construct_row($extra = array()) |
|||
03-01-2017, 15:03,
(Modification du message : 03-01-2017, 15:13 par exdiogene.)
|
|||
|
|||
RE: Page Manager Erreur
Il faut vérifier TOUS les éléments d'un tableau pour éviter les messages d'erreur dans tout le code.
Par exemple pour votre code précédent : Code PHP : function construct_row($extra = array()){ Mais il est fort probable qu'une erreur de même type se produise ailleurs dans une autre partie du code et il faudra toutes les corriger ou supprimer l'affichage du message d'erreur. D'après votre message d'erreur c'est la ligne 325 du plugin "page_manager" qui pose encore problème lors de l'insertion de la nouvelle rangée dans la table : Code : $table->construct_row(); |
|||
03-01-2017, 16:35,
|
|||
|
|||
RE: Page Manager Erreur
Il y a de l'information sur ce problème ici :
https://community.mybb.com/thread-152252.html Mais il semble que "Page Manager" ne renseigne pas complètement les variables de la table à afficher et c'est cela qui cause le problème avec les nouvelles versions de PHP... |
|||
03-01-2017, 23:29,
|
|||
|
|||
RE: Page Manager Erreur
Malheureusement je n'y connais pas grand chose, et encore moins en anglais :/
|
|||
03-01-2017, 23:32,
|
|||
|
|||
RE: Page Manager Erreur
Je vous recommande donc de modifier le code tel que mentionné ici et cela devrait régler le problème :
http://mybb.fr/thread-7662-post-45485.html#pid45485 |
|||
« Sujet précédent | Sujet suivant »
|
Utilisateur(s) parcourant ce sujet : 3 visiteur(s)